Best if you want to: Pamper tired footsies with a deep-cleansing, clay mask that draws out impurities as it dries, then washes off to reveal softer, recharged feet.

Best for: all skin types

How it works:
  • Community Trade peppermint oil promotes a cooling sensation to leave feet feeling refreshed and helps to combat odor.
  • Kaolin clay helps to draw out impurities to deeply cleanse skin.
  • Community Trade cocoa butter is an excellent moisturizer that melts at body temperature, while Community Trade sesame oil moisturizes and softens skin.

The Body Shop® difference: In marginalized communities round the world, Community Trade provides a fair, reliable wage to our suppliers, business advice should they want it, and the respect they deserve. It's about forming long-term trading relationships, like the one we have with the co-operative of small-scale farmers who provide us with our sesame oil. We’ve been buying this great, easily absorbed oil from them since 1993. So whenever you treat your feet to our Peppermint Foot Mask, you are also providing the farmers of Juan Francisco Paz Silva Co-operative in Nicaragua with vital income.

Water, Kaolin, Sesamum Indicum (Sesame) Oil, Glyceryl Stearate, Glycerin, PEG-100 Stearate, Mentha Piperita (Peppermint) Oil, Menthol, Eucalyptus Globulus Oil, Sodium Hydroxmethylglycinate, Xanthan Gum, PEG-150 Distearate, Red 33, Red 4, Blue 1.
Soak feet using the Peppermint Cooling Foot Soak beforehand.
Massage onto the feet and calves and leave for ten to fifteen minutes (mask will not dry). Rinse thoroughly.

Our peppermint is grown in the rich fens of Norfolk, England, and is produced by our Community Trade expert distiller, Norfolk Essential Oils. Our trade with them helps to give new life to a community that was under threat, providing an income and revitalising local businesses.

Our Community Traded sesame oil is sourced from a co-operative of small-scale farmers in a remote area of Nicaragua. We've been buying this great, easily absorbed oil from them since 1993. With every product you buy, you help provide these farmers with vital income.
